blob: d08d2db05ed7718963eb71b0670a5cd7a380e782 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
|
/* $Id$ */
#include "md5ossl.h"
int
rb_digest_md5osslevp_Init(EVP_MD_CTX *pctx)
{
return EVP_DigestInit_ex(pctx, EVP_md5(), NULL);
}
int
rb_digest_md5osslevp_Finish(EVP_MD_CTX *pctx, unsigned char *digest)
{
/* if EVP_DigestFinal_ex fails, we ignore that */
return EVP_DigestFinal_ex(pctx, digest, NULL);
}
|